[PATCH 8/8] arm64: stacktrace: track hyp stacks in unwinder's address space

Mark Rutland mark.rutland at arm.com
Mon Aug 1 05:12:09 PDT 2022


Currently unwind_next_frame_record() has an optional callback to convert
the address space of the FP. This is necessary for the NVHE unwinder,
which tracks the stacks in the hyp VA space, but accesses the frame
records in the kernel VA space.

This is a bit unfortunate since it clutters unwind_next_frame_record(),
which will get in the way of future rework.

Instead, this patch changes the NVHE unwinder to track the stacks in the
kernel's VA space and translate to FP prior to calling
unwind_next_frame_record(). This removes the need for the translate_fp()
callback, as all unwinders consistently track stacks in the native
address space of the unwinder.

At the same time, this patch consolidates the generation of the stack
addreses behind the stackinfo_get_*() helpers.
